Living With Diabetes Means Living With Foot Problems

Diabetes often comes with a long list of foot issues that make finding the right shoes extremely difficult. Many people with diabetes experience:

  • Diabetic neuropathy pain — burning, tingling, sharp pain, or numbness
  • Loss of sensation
  • Foot swelling (edema) 
  • Bunions, hammertoes, and toe deformities c
  • Sensitive skin
  • Heel pain and forefoot pressure 
  • Foot fatigue 

When neuropathy reduces sensation, these problems can quietly worsen — without warning.

Why Regular Shoes Hurt Diabetic Feet?

Most everyday shoes are designed for style — not sensitive feet.

  • Tight toe space creates pressure and rubbing
  • Hard soles increase impact with every step
  • Narrow openings make shoes difficult to put on
  • Hidden friction inside the shoe causes discomfort you may not feel right away

For people with diabetes, these small issues can quickly turn into daily pain and mobility problems.
